Lectotypification of Plectocarpon diedertzianum (Arthoniales)

Plectocarpon diedertzianum Y.Joshi, Upadhyay & Chandra was described from India from four different parmelioid host genera. The figure illustrating the holotype specimen in the original publication appears to represent heterogeneous elements. Therefore, a re-examination of the holotype specimen was performed and confirmed the presence of two similar but distinct arthonialean lichenicolous species belonging to Opegrapha melanospila on Parmotrema reticulatum and to a Plectocarpon species on Myelochroa aurulenta. As a consequence, the name P. diedertzianum is lectotypified on the lichenicolous fungus growing on Myelochroa.
